Profiles Volunteer Bob Sage has contributed to the success of Farm Bureau in many ways. He is serving his third term as president of Geauga County Farm Bureau. He was on the county Farm Bureau board as the secretary and vice president. He also has worked membership, was the government affairs chairman and was involved in an advisory council. On the state level he was influential in deciding the plans and goals of OFBF as a member of the Envision Future committee. He also has been a member of the state policy development committee and a delegate to the state annual meeting. "Farm Bureau has the power to work with the government to mold, change and modify regulations and rules facing farmers," Sage said. "The voice of Farm Bureau is impressive and helpful to the farmer." Sage is currently the secretary for the Ohio Apple Marketing Association. He is also a member of the Ohio Fruit Growers Society, where he is past president, and a member of the Ohio Vegetable and Potato Growers Association. He and his family grow a variety of fruits and vegetables and run Sages’ Apple Farm Market. He and his wife, Linda, reside in Chardon and have two children Ben, 23, and Jordan, 10.
